Aaron Ramsey reveals that confidence is currently high throughout the Welsh squad.

Captain Aaron Ramsey has revealed that the current Wales squad are "buzzing" after a positive run of results.

Under the guidance of Gary Speed, the Dragons have won three of their last four matches, including victories over Switzerland and Bulgaria in recent Euro 2012 qualifying matches.

As a result, midfielder Ramsey has claimed that confidence is high in the Wales camp and that he "can't wait" to represent his country again.

"I thought we showed some great character," said the 20-year-old. "The dressing room is buzzing, the lads are all happy with the way things are going and they have grown into the role and into the style we want to play.

"I can't wait to get out there for Wales again."

Ramsey is the youngster player to have ever skippered the Welsh national team.
